Gather and prep your ingredients

Before we get into the cooking, let’s make sure we have everything ready. The success of your Baked Million Dollar Ravioli Casserole starts with quality ingredients. Here’s what you’ll need:

  • 9 oz of refrigerated ravioli (cheese or meat-filled)
  • 1 lb of ground beef or turkey bacon, finely chopped
  • 1 cup of chicken ham, diced
  • 1 medium onion, finely chopped
  • 2 cloves of garlic, minced
  • 1 jar (24 oz) of marinara sauce
  • 1 cup of ricotta cheese
  • 1 cup of sour cream
  • 2 cups of shredded mozzarella cheese
  • 1 tsp of Italian seasoning
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Prepare your cooking space by measuring out your ingredients. This not only saves time but also helps you stay organized and focused.

Cook the meat mixture

In a large skillet, start by cooking your ground beef (or turkey bacon) over medium heat. As the meat cooks, add in the chopped onion and minced garlic.

Why add the onion and garlic early? They release such delightful flavors that permeate the meat. Keep stirring until the meat is browned, and the onions are tender—around 7 to 10 minutes.

Once everything is nicely cooked, pour in the marinara sauce and stir it all together. Let it simmer on low while you move on to the next step.

Mix the ricotta and sour cream

While the meat mixture is simmering, take a large bowl and combine the ricotta cheese, sour cream, Italian seasoning, and a pinch of salt and pepper. This creamy blend adds depth to your Baked Million Dollar Ravioli Casserole, and trust me, it’s a game changer.

Once mixed, taste it—need a little more salt or seasoning? This is your chance to adjust before it all goes into the oven.

Layer the ingredients

Let’s get to the fun part: assembling the dish!

  1. Start with a layer of the meat mixture on the bottom of a greased 9×13 baking dish to ensure nothing sticks.
  2. Place half of the ravioli over the meat mixture.
  3. Spread half the ricotta and sour cream mixture on top of the ravioli.
  4. Sprinkle a layer of shredded mozzarella cheese over it.
  5. Repeat the process by adding the remaining meat, another layer of ravioli, the rest of the ricotta mixture, and finish with more mozzarella.

Make sure to end with a generous sprinkle of cheese on top because who doesn’t love that melty goodness?

Bake to perfection

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Once preheated, cover your casserole dish with foil and bake for about 25 minutes. After that, remove the foil and bake for another 15-20 minutes or until the cheese is bubbly and golden brown.

Once it’s out of the oven, let it rest for about 10-15 minutes before serving. This step is essential, as it lets all the flavors meld together beautifully.

Can I make this casserole ahead of time?

Absolutely! You can prep your Baked Million Dollar Ravioli Casserole a day in advance. Simply assemble the casserole, cover it tightly with plastic wrap, and store it in the fridge. When you’re ready to bake, remove the wrap and let it sit at room temperature for about 30 minutes before popping it in the oven. This method not only saves you time during busy weekdays but allows the flavors to meld beautifully overnight.

How do I store leftovers properly?

Storing leftovers of your Baked Million Dollar Ravioli Casserole is a breeze. Transfer any uneaten portions to an airtight container and keep them in the refrigerator. Enjoy them within 3–4 days. If you’d like to save them longer, this casserole freezes wonderfully! Just make sure it’s cooled completely before transferring to a freezer-safe container. It can last up to three months in the freezer. When ready to enjoy, thaw in the fridge overnight and bake until heated through. Trust me, you’ll love knowing a delicious meal is just a warm-up away!

Baked Million Dollar Ravioli Casserole

Baked Million Dollar Ravioli Casserole with Turkey Bacon Bliss

Save Recipe

A creamy, cheesy, and savory baked casserole that brings together ravioli and turkey bacon for a deliciously unique meal.

  • Total Time: 1 hour
  • Yield: 6 servings 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 12 ounces frozen cheese ravioli
  • 6 slices turkey bacon
  • 2 cups marinara sauce
  • 1 cup ricotta cheese
  • 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
  • 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
  • 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. In a skillet, cook the turkey bacon until crispy, then chop into small pieces.
  3. In a baking dish, layer half of the frozen ravioli at the bottom.
  4. Spread half of the marinara sauce over the ravioli, followed by half of the ricotta cheese.
  5. Sprinkle half of the cooked turkey bacon, half of the mozzarella, and half of the Parmesan on top.
  6. Repeat the layers with the remaining ingredients.
  7. Cover the dish with aluminum foil and bake for 25 minutes.
  8. Remove the foil and bake for an additional 15 minutes or until cheese is bubbly and golden.
  9. Let it cool for a few moments before serving.
